Adding Rational Expressions with Common Denominators
To add or subtract fractions or rational expressions with common denominators, all you do is add or subtract the numerators. You then write the sum or difference over the common denominator, and simplify.
Here are some fractional examples that should be familiar to you:
5/8 + 1/8 = (5+1)/8 9/16 -7/16 = (9-7)/16
= 6/8 = 2/16
= 3/4 =1/8
